Azamara Cruises is returning to Alaska for the 2026 season.

After a seven-year hiatus, Azamara Pursuit will sail 10- to 13-day Alaska cruises with extended stays in port of 10+ hours, cultural encounters with indigenous communities, and wildlife excursions.

“It’s clear from our conversations with agents and customers that Alaska remains a bucket-list destination.”

“We’re delighted to be announcing our return in summer 2026″ says David Duff, UK Managing Director at Azamara Cruises.

” With our extended stays, we are thrilled to deliver the Azamara experience in a destination that has captivated the hearts of travelers” Dondra Ritzenthaler, CEO of Azamara Cruises added.

Azamara Cruises’ Alaska return includes 27 late-night departures to maximize guests’ time in port and extended stays in ports such as Juneau, Wrangell, Skagway and Ketchikan.

There will be access to remote locations such as Kodiak, known for its wildlife spotting; Dutch Harbor, the gateway to the Aleutian Islands; and Icy Strait Point.
